Nikon Slug Hunter for semi-auto 308
This 3-9x40 Nikon Slug-hunter sits atop a bullpup 308. I wanted a very durable scope, and believed that this scope, which was meant to be used with a slug-slinging shotgun, would be durable enough. So far there have been no issues, and I do not anticipate any. The glass is very clear, sharp image, and the BDC is easy to use; although it will be specific to your firearm/caliber combination. The price seems high for a 3-9, but if it is durable enough to outlive a hard-kicking firearm, then it is money well-spent.
I do recommend this scope.
Pros: durability, clarity
Cons: possibly price
